What body areas can a TENS machine or nerve stimulator target?

TENS machine and nerve stimulator devices support multi-area therapy via foot pads for lower limb stimulation or electrode patches for the back, arms, and calves. These pain relief machines are suitable for sciatica, cervical pain, shoulder stiffness, and general nerve-related discomfort.

How does an EMS machine support muscle recovery differently from a TENS machine?

An EMS machine directly contracts and relaxes muscle fibres, making it an effective muscle stimulator for recovery, toning, and post-exercise conditioning. A TENS machine targets nerve pathways to block pain signals and trigger endorphin release, focusing primarily on pain relief and nerve stimulation.
